Ezewuzie Makes Case For Reserved Seats For Disability Community In National Assembly.

by Inclusive News Network

Governor Willie Obiano’s Special Adviser on Disability Matters in Anambra State, Barrister Chuks Ezewuzie has called on the National Assembly to come up with a bill that will create seats for persons with disabilities at both houses of the National Assembly.

Addressing the House of Representatives Special Committee on the review of the 1999 Constitution, Barrister Ezewuzie suggested an amendment to Section 48, Section 49 and Section 71 of the 1999 Constitution to include 35millions Nigerians living with disabilities in the national body politics.

Ezewuzie commended the law makers for supporting a similar bill which seeks to create additional 111 seats for women in both houses. The said bill has already passed a second reading in the Green Chambers.
